Transaction 74e413396f78eaf7433a144b1210711803ae02aa6694f83801f31f1662345b56

46 Input
2 Outputs
  • 74e413396f78eaf7433a144b1210711803ae02aa6694f83801f31f1662345b56:0
  • value  302197800
    address  1BtSE7AXX5RuRRcnbhiM3qBwMhEYwxqBsm
  • 74e413396f78eaf7433a144b1210711803ae02aa6694f83801f31f1662345b56:1
  • value  221703125
    address  3QoN5gV6Pwrzz8QoJ7NyWseStgtLbi77Gp